discuz附件不用服务器带宽
时间 : 2024-05-06 12:06: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
最佳答案
一、背景
随着网络技术的发展,互联网上的各种应用越来越多。在这些应用中,论坛是用户最为喜爱的一种。Discuz是国内较为知名的论坛软件之一,它提供了丰富的功能,而它的论坛附件功能也是让用户最为关注的一个。
二、什么是Discuz附件?
Discuz附件是指用户在论坛上上传的各种文件,包括图片、音频、视频等。论坛管理员在设置中可以指定附件的格式和大小,一些较大的文件还需要服务器的带宽来进行传输。
三、为什么不需要服务器带宽?
在实际应用中,如果Discuz论坛的附件文件不是通过服务器传输的,而是通过其他手段传输,那么服务器的带宽就不会被消耗。具体来说,可以通过以下两种方式来实现:
1. 文件服务器
为了让上传的附件文件不使用服务器带宽,可以将文件存储到专门的文件服务器上,然后在论坛的设置中将附件的路径更改为文件服务器的地址。这样,用户上传文件时,文件是直接上传到文件服务器上的,不会占用论坛服务器的带宽,用户下载文件时,也是直接从文件服务器上进行下载,同样不会对论坛服务器的带宽产生影响。
2. 分布式文件系统
另外一种解决方案是采用分布式文件系统,比如Hadoop Distributed File System(HDFS)和FastDFS。这些系统可以将文件分散存储到多个服务器上,实现负载均衡和高可用性的同时,也能实现文件共享和统一管理。
四、总结
综上所述,Discuz论坛的附件,本来需要服务器的带宽来实现用户上传和下载,但是通过文件服务器或分布式文件系统,这些附件就可以不使用服务器的带宽了。这些解决方案不仅能够节省服务器的带宽资源,还能够提高文件的安全性和可靠性。
其他答案
众所周知,Discuz(大名鼎鼎的Discuz!)作为一款知名的论坛系统,在网站建设中起到了极其重要的作用。然而在使用Discuz的过程中,有时候会遇到一些问题,比如论坛附件占用服务器带宽等。针对这个问题,我们可以从以下几个方面来进行分层次的阐述。
我们可以通过使用CDN技术来解决此问题。CDN(Content Delivery Network)即内容分发网络,它可以在全球范围内分布的节点服务器直接加载网站的静态资源,如图片、音频、视频等内容。通过将Discuz的附件资源使用CDN进行加速分发,可以大大减轻服务器的带宽压力。这样,用户在访问论坛时,可以更快速地获取附件资源,提升了用户体验的同时也减轻了服务器的负担。
可以考虑对附件资源进行压缩和优化。在Discuz中,用户上传的附件资源往往涉及图片、视频等多媒体内容,这些资源文件的体积较大,导致在用户下载浏览时会消耗大量的带宽。为了减轻服务器的带宽压力,我们可以通过对附件资源进行压缩和优化处理,减小文件体积的同时保证其清晰度和质量,从而减少带宽的使用。
采用无带宽存储方式也是解决此问题的有效途径。现如今,一些云存储服务商提供了无带宽存储的服务,即用户只需支付存储费用,无需支付带宽费用。通过将Discuz的附件资源存储到这些云存储平台上,可以有效地降低服务器的带宽消耗。当用户访问论坛并下载附件时,实际上是直接从云存储平台获取资源,而非通过论坛服务器传输,这样就能够避免影响到论坛服务器的带宽使用。
针对Discuz附件占用服务器带宽过大的问题,我们可以通过使用CDN技术、对附件资源进行压缩和优化、以及采用无带宽存储方式等多种途径来解决。这些方法既能有效减轻服务器的带宽压力,提升用户体验,又能够降低网站运营成本,是解决该问题的可行方案。
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章